Key Responsibilities

  • Our Forklift Drivers play an integral part in making sure that we exceed company key performance indicators (KPI) measures and continue to deliver an efficient, safe, and vital healthcare service to our customers.
  • Accountable for operating the reach/counterbalance forklift
  • Use wireless RF scanning equipment to ensure accuracy of inventory
  • Inspecting maintenance of forklifts and other material handling equipment.
